Windows stores local user passwords in a hashed format inside a file called the (Security Account Manager), located at C:\Windows\System32\config\SAM . This file is locked and encrypted when Windows is running. However, when you boot from an external medium like the All Windows Password Remover 7.01 ISO , the target Windows installation is offline—its files are just data on a hard drive.
